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from London Fields to Birkdale start from as little as £45.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from London Fields to Birkdale start from £85.10 one way, or £121.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from London Fields to Birkdale are available for £189.50 one way, or £379.00 return

Amenities and Facilities at London Fields

London Fields station is committed to making your travel experience smooth and convenient. Although there is no ticket office at the station, ticket machines are readily available to ensure you can collect pre-booked tickets with ease. For those who require assistance, the station also offers acc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and step-free access to make navigation straightforward for everyone. While there's no waiting room, there is a convenient seating area for those short stops or while waiting for your train.

Although amenities like refreshment facilities and shops aren't available within the station, the surrounding area of London Fields boasts plenty of cafes, restaurants, and local shops. So, you can easily grab a coffee or a snack before embarking on your journey. As for staying connected, public Wi-Fi access is available, enabling you to effectively plan your day or simply unwind.

Facilities and Amenities at Birkdale Station

At the heart of Birkdale Station, you'll find a well-organized and passenger-friendly environment. Though ticket machines are unavailable, tickets can be conveniently collected from the ticket office, which opens bright and early. Smartcards are issued here, with validators available to ensure seamless travel on the network. Plus, an induction loop is installed to assist those with hearing needs.

Your comfort is well-catered with step-free access throughout the station. It's classified under ‘Category A’, meaning every platform is easily reachable via the level crossing, ideal for passengers with reduced mobility. While the station lacks retail shops, vending machines for cold drinks and snacks are available, allowing for a quick refreshment on the go. Don’t forget to use the secure cycle storage if you’re arriving by bike, with 24 protected spaces under CCTV surveillance ensuring your peace of mind.
